recreational gymnastics
Recreational gymnastics is a fantastic way for gymnasts to get started in the sport of gymnastics. In these programs gymnasts will focus on learning the basic fundamentals to gymnastics and progress through advancing their skill sets. In our classes we will support all of our gymnasts through our key values of: fun, friendship, fundamentals and fitness. We offer a range of different recreational class options at both our Bardon and Enoggera Venues.
benefits of gymnastics
Enhances their co-ordination and agility, for total body awareness and balance.
Develops posture and confident body movement, including the ability to land safely
Understand where their body is in space and develop depth perception
Enhances creativity and builds self-confidence, for sport and life
Develops strength and flexibility
Develops healthy minds and bodies for now and later life
how does my child progress?
Each child is special and unique in their own way. Here at WDYC we focus on supporting progression when a child is ready to do. On average gymnasts tend to spend 12 months at minimum in a class prior to progressing. This is to give them enough time to master the skills on their report to the required standards.
Every term we do in class testing which is designed to observe when a child is ready physically and emotionally to progress to the next class in our recreational program. Testing is usually done on an advised week each term — reception will email details to all families each term. Please refer to our Calendar for the current testing weeks each term. Post testing weeks our team will send out your child’s progress report. We will then go through all of our gymnasts reports and identify gymnast who are ready to progress (usually when they are only missing 1-2 skills on the report card). If your child is ready to progress we will then contact you.
